Tolmer Falls is certainly one of the most spectacular falls in Litchfield national Park. You can only access the bottom of the waterfall accompanied by a permitted guide as Tolmer Gorge is inhabited by colonies of rare Ghost Bats and Orange Horseshoe Bats.
Human presence in the gorge may cause them to abandon roosting sites and threaten their survival.
